Spatial Planning and Layout Logic

Effective castle-scale planning depends on clear circulation, defined zones, and structural logic that supports heavy millwork without compromising daily use. Typical configurations integrate an antechamber, primary rest area, and adjoining dressing or study, all sequenced to manage sound, light, and visibility. Headroom, column positioning, and service shafts influence ceiling options, while window placement shapes views, privacy, and daylight quality. Early coordination with structure and MEP ensures that ambitious dimensions remain buildable and code-compliant.

Room Geometry and Proportions

Rectilinear footprints with balanced sightlines simplify large-scale detailing and reduce acoustic flutter. Key ratios include moderately high ceilings, generous reveal at windows, and balanced wall areas to anchor monumental furniture. Depth in plan allows layered vignettes—entrance buffer, dressing core, rest core—rather than a single expansive void that can feel impersonal. Maintaining consistent grid dimensions supports offsite fabrication and repeatable joinery.

Functional Zoning and Service Paths

Clear separation between sleep, storage, and ancillary functions prevents interference and supports sophisticated housekeeping. Ensuite baths, dressing volumes, and linen rooms should align with service corridors so that staff circulation does not cross primary resting areas. Integrated media, climate control, and lighting scenes allow the suite to transition between day mode, rest mode, and guest mode without reconfiguring furniture.

Design Language and Material Palette

A coherent material strategy prevents castle schemes from reading as pastiche and instead supports a quiet, modern luxury. Prioritize materials that age gracefully, perform acoustically, and tolerate maintenance cycles: engineered stone and solid hardwoods, veneered panels with stable substrates, and textiles with high rub counts. Limiting the palette to two or three neutrals with a single accent tone preserves clarity, while restrained metal finishes frame rather than dominate surfaces.

Walls, Millwork, and Detailing

Layered wall assemblies combine framing, service access, and thermal control behind large, uninterrupted panel runs. Raised bases, chair rails, and picture moldings articulate planes without overwhelming proportion. Consider prefabricated cased openings for doors and reveals that shadow detail, reducing on-site variability and installation time.

Flooring and Acoustic Strategy

Substantial underlayment and perimeter isolation minimize impact sound, especially where bedrooms are stacked above living spaces. Wide-plank formats can read more regal than segmented layouts, but joint spacing and deflection limits must align with substructure stiffness. In multi-floor schemes, coordinate finishes to maintain visual continuity while allowing each level to perform structurally.

Fixture, Lighting, and Technology Selection

Fixture decisions shape both aesthetics and usability, so prioritize ergonomics, dimming range, and serviceability from the outset. Integrated lighting at coves, ceilings, and furniture surfaces supports scene-based control, while concealed conduits and raceways preserve clean ceilings and future adaptability. Low-voltage and networked controls reduce panel complexity and enable precise zoning, but require careful commissioning to avoid interoperability issues.

Bed, Bath, and Custom Elements

  • King platform or sleigh bed with reinforced foundations and low visual clutter
  • Freestanding tub, large-format curbless shower, and dual-vanity layout when applicable
  • Concealed storage, pull-out luggage, and integrated workspace near daylight
  • ADA-compliant fixtures and clearances where accessibility is required

Control Strategy and Fail-safes

Scene presets for wake, rest, and event modes should be simple, with manual override at each fixture. Physical bypass switches near the bed and door ensure systems fail to a safe, comfortable state. Redundant pathways for critical circuits and labeled distribution panels reduce troubleshooting time and support maintenance staff.

Maintenance, Longevity, and Day-to-Day Use

Castle-inspired suites benefit from planned maintenance cycles that protect finishes and mechanisms. Wood millwork benefits from periodic cleaning and controlled humidity, while upholstery and textiles require rotation and professional cleaning on fixed intervals. Lighting controls and motorized assemblies should undergo routine diagnostics at least biannually to ensure smooth operation. Clear user manuals and labeled zones reduce reliance on specialized staff and support consistent performance across seasons.
